java 排序總結

共有8種排序方法: 選擇排序、快速排序、希爾排序、堆排序不是穩定的排序算法, 冒泡排序、插入排序、歸併排序和基數排序是穩定的排序算法。 冒泡排序 選擇排序 插入排序 希爾排序 快速排序 堆排序 歸併排序 基數排序 冒泡排序 穩定的排序法,最壞時間複雜度和平均時間複雜度爲O(n^2),最好時間複雜度爲 O(n),只需要一個額外的空間所以空間複雜度爲最佳。 冒泡排序的基本思想:遍歷整個數組,在遍歷中依
相關文章
相關標籤/搜索